>>>>>> I'm sure this either does not build or does not work. There's a 
>>>>>> call to drm_dev_alloc(), which initialized the DRM device. You 
>>>>>> need to assign the returned device here. The embedding of dev only 
>>>>>> work after you switched to devm_drm_dev_alloc() in the next patch.
>>>>>>
>>>>>> For the patch at hand, just keep struct hibmc_drm_private.dev as a 
>>>>>> pointer and you should be fine.
>>>>>>
>>>>> Changing drm_device *dev to drm_device dev and using 
>>>>> devm_drm_dev_alloc does not easily split into two patches.
>>>>> The patch does not compile well on its own, but it will compile 
>>>>> fine with patch #2.
>>>>> Can patch #1 and patch #2 be combined into a single patch,just like 
>>>>> V1.
>>>>
>>>> Most of the code in this patch does
>>>>
>>>>    struct drm_device *dev = &priv->dev;
>>>>
>>>> to get dev as a local variable. Why don't you do
>>>>
>>>>    struct drm_device *dev = priv->dev;
>>>>
>>>> ?
>>>>
>>>> That's all that's really needed.
>>>
>>> +    priv = devm_drm_dev_alloc(&pdev->dev, &hibmc_driver,
>>> +                  struct hibmc_drm_private, dev);
>>> devm_drm_dev_alloc function requires parameter 4, dev must be a 
>>> non-pointer for it to work. so had to change dev in the 
>>> hibmc_drm_private  to non-pointer.
>>> This is also the reason to change drm_device *dev to drm_device dev.
>>
>> Yes, but that's what patch 2 is about. Patch 1 is about simplifying 
>> these pointer dereferences into local variables. For this, all you 
>> need is
>>
>>      struct drm_device *dev = priv->dev;
> I'm sorry, I still don't understand what you mean.The latest code on the 
> drm branch looks like this "struct drm_device *dev = priv->dev;"
> If I change the dev of hibmc_drm_private to local variables, I won't be 
> able to assign it like this "struct drm_device *dev = priv->dev;", right?
>>
>> In patch 2, these lines are then changed to
>>
>>      struct drm_device *dev = &priv->dev;
>>
>> That makes 2 self-contained patches.
